If you love hockey, then scoring a job in the NHL is a good goal to have. There are some jobs in the NHL that are better than others. Here are some of the “cooler” jobs that the NHL has to offer.
Coolest Gigs in the National Hockey League
1. Equipment Manager
A hockey team’s equipment manager is definitely a problem solver. Responsibilities can vary from handling laundry, ordering supplies, and drying gloves and pads in between games. If there is a piece of equipment or uniform the players use during games, the equipment manager should know all about it. Believe it or not, equipment managers are more important to the team than you may think. They are there for anything the players need before, during, and after games.
Qualifications:
- Attention to detail
- Multi-tasking
- Lots and lots of patience
Average salary: $55,000

3. Director of Operations
Think about everything that’s involved in an NHL game. There’s music, food, drinks, security, and even tickets. The operations manager is responsible for making sure everything that needs to happen to at an NHL event goes off without a hitch. They must hire food vendors, ticket sales employees, and anyone else needed to get the job done.
To summarize, the operations manager makes sure the arena is game-time ready by organizing crews to set up the rink, making sure the parking lots are cleared of debris and making sure the staff is ready to provide a top-of-the-line experience.
Qualifications:
- Team management
- Attention to detail
- Problem-solving
- Communication skills
Average salary: $91,000

5. Zamboni Driver
If you think an ice surfacing machine driver’s job is jumping on a Zamboni anytime you can; you’re sadly mistaken. While this job doesn’t require formal education, you must have a passion for perfect ice. There’s actually a lot that goes into the perfect ice: the right temperature, the right speed, and all of the right settings on the machine.
Qualifications:
- Basic mechanical knowledge
- Ability to drive in circles
- Passion for the perfect ice
Average salary: $31,000
